#!/bin/bash # Create a new calendar event # Usage: cal-create.sh [location] [description] [allday] [recurrence] # Date format: "YYYY-MM-DD HH:MM" or "YYYY-MM-DD" for all-day events # Recurrence format: iCalendar RRULE (e.g., "FREQ=WEEKLY;COUNT=4" or "FREQ=DAILY;UNTIL=20260201") # Examples: # cal-create.sh Personal "Meeting" "2026-01-15 10:00" "2026-01-15 11:00" # cal-create.sh Personal "Vacation" "2026-02-01" "2026-02-05" "" "Beach trip" true # cal-create.sh Personal "Weekly Standup" "2026-01-20 09:00" "2026-01-20 09:30" "Zoom" "" false "FREQ=WEEKLY;COUNT=10" CALENDAR="${1:-}" SUMMARY="${2:-}" START_DATE="${3:-}" END_DATE="${4:-}" LOCATION="${5:-}" DESCRIPTION="${6:-}" ALL_DAY="${7:-false}" RECURRENCE="${8:-}" if [ -z "$CALENDAR" ] || [ -z "$SUMMARY" ] || [ -z "$START_DATE" ] || [ -z "$END_DATE" ]; then echo "Usage: cal-create.sh [location] [description] [allday] [recurrence]" echo "Date format: 'YYYY-MM-DD HH:MM' or 'YYYY-MM-DD' for all-day" exit 1 fi osascript - "$CALENDAR" "$SUMMARY" "$START_DATE" "$END_DATE" "$LOCATION" "$DESCRIPTION" "$ALL_DAY" "$RECURRENCE" <<'EOF' on splitString(theString, theDelimiter) set oldDelimiters to AppleScript's text item delimiters set AppleScript's text item delimiters to theDelimiter set theArray to every text item of theString set AppleScript's text item delimiters to oldDelimiters return theArray end splitString on parseDate(dateStr) set dateParts to my splitString(dateStr, " ") set ymdParts to my splitString(item 1 of dateParts, "-") set theDate to current date set year of theDate to (item 1 of ymdParts) as integer set month of theDate to (item 2 of ymdParts) as integer set day of theDate to (item 3 of ymdParts) as integer if (count of dateParts) > 1 then set timeParts to my splitString(item 2 of dateParts, ":") set hours of theDate to (item 1 of timeParts) as integer set minutes of theDate to (item 2 of timeParts) as integer set seconds of theDate to 0 else set hours of theDate to 0 set minutes of theDate to 0 set seconds of theDate to 0 end if return theDate end parseDate on run argv set calendarName to item 1 of argv as string set eventSummary to item 2 of argv as string set startDateStr to item 3 of argv as string set endDateStr to item 4 of argv as string set eventLocation to item 5 of argv as string set eventDescription to item 6 of argv as string set isAllDay to item 7 of argv as string set eventRecurrence to item 8 of argv as string set startDate to my parseDate(startDateStr) set endDate to my parseDate(endDateStr) tell application "Calendar" try set cal to calendar calendarName on error return "Error: Calendar '" & calendarName & "' not found" end try if not (writable of cal) then return "Error: Calendar '" & calendarName & "' is read-only" end if set eventProps to {summary:eventSummary, start date:startDate, end date:endDate} if isAllDay is "true" then set eventProps to eventProps & {allday event:true} end if set newEvent to make new event at end of events of cal with properties eventProps if eventLocation is not "" then set location of newEvent to eventLocation end if if eventDescription is not "" then set description of newEvent to eventDescription end if if eventRecurrence is not "" then set recurrence of newEvent to eventRecurrence end if return "Created event: " & (uid of newEvent) end tell end run EOF
